Dietary Supplement, Mixed Carotenoid Complex, Natural Source, Purity and Potency Guaranteed, BetaCareAll is a unique mixed carotenoid formula sourced from whole algae and sustainable palm oil providing natural beta-carotene. It also provides other beneficial carotenoids such as lycopene, lutein, and zeaxanthin. Beta-carotene is converted to vitamin A in the body, which is essential to many body processes, including maintenance of healthy skin, vision, mucous membranes, bones and teeth, and immune function. Carotenoids are antioxidants that help protect us from damage to cellular structures throughout the human body. Is this dose toxic? I’ve heard that 25000 IU of Vitamin A a day has negative side effects and toxicity.

Beta-carotene converts into vitamin A. If there is enough witamin A in body, the conversion of beta-carotene decreases. That’s why beta-carotene is safe source of Vitamin A and high doses will not lead to hypervitaminosis A.
